The Japan Automotive Central Multi-Antenna Access Points Market is witnessing significant growth as vehicles become increasingly connected, demanding robust communication infrastructure. Central multi-antenna access points (APs) are key components that enable seamless connectivity in modern vehicles, supporting various communication systems such as Wi-Fi, cellular networks, and V2X (vehicle-to-everything) communication. These devices are essential for ensuring uninterrupted data flow between vehicles and external networks, contributing to the overall driving experience and safety. The market is evolving with advances in automotive technologies and the growing need for high-bandwidth applications.

The market is segmented by application into two main categories: Private Cars and Commercial Vehicles, each with distinct needs and growth trajectories. These segments reflect different levels of connectivity requirements, with private cars often focusing on enhancing in-car entertainment and convenience features, while commercial vehicles prioritize fleet management and operational efficiency.
Private cars, which constitute a significant portion of the Japan Automotive Central Multi-Antenna Access Points Market, have seen increasing adoption of connected technologies. The demand for multi-antenna systems in private vehicles is driven by the growing reliance on in-car entertainment systems, navigation, and internet connectivity. As consumers expect faster internet speeds and better connectivity during their commutes, automakers are integrating advanced multi-antenna solutions to meet these needs. These systems not only improve Wi-Fi and Bluetooth connectivity but also support critical safety features such as real-time traffic updates and autonomous driving functions.
In addition to enhancing the user experience, the integration of central multi-antenna access points in private cars also contributes to the development of next-generation features, including vehicle-to-vehicle (V2V) and vehicle-to-infrastructure (V2I) communications. The expansion of 5G networks is further fueling this trend, as consumers and manufacturers alike push for faster data transmission to support applications like adv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S) and in-car infotainment. As the demand for smart, connected vehicles grows, private cars are expected to remain a dominant application segment in the market.
Commercial vehicles represent a key segment in the Japan Automotive Central Multi-Antenna Access Points Market, with a strong focus on enhancing fleet management capabilities and operational efficiency. These vehicles require reliable and secure communication networks to support a wide range of applications, including real-time vehicle tracking, telematics, and remote diagnostics. Central multi-antenna systems enable uninterrupted data exchange between the vehicle and central servers, facilitating the monitoring of fuel usage, driver behavior, and vehicle maintenance. This capability is crucial for reducing operational costs and improving fleet productivity.
Moreover, the integration of multi-antenna access points in commercial vehicles supports the adoption of advanced technologies such as autonomous driving and platooning, where vehicles travel in close formation to reduce fuel consumption and improve traffic flow. As the logistics and transportation industries increasingly embrace smart technologies, the demand for reliable communication systems in commercial vehicles will continue to rise. The ability to support high-bandwidth applications such as 5G connectivity and V2X communications makes commercial vehicles a key growth driver in the automotive multi-antenna access points market.
Several key trends are shaping the Japan Automotive Central Multi-Antenna Access Points Market. First, the rise of autonomous vehicles is driving demand for enhanced connectivity solutions. As autonomous vehicles rely on constant communication with external networks, the need for high-speed, low-latency connectivity is crucial. Multi-antenna access points enable these vehicles to remain connected with other vehicles, traffic systems, and infrastructure, facilitating the safe and efficient operation of autonomous systems.
Another notable trend is the increasing implementation of 5G technology in the automotive sector. With the rollout of 5G networks, automakers are integrating multi-antenna systems that can handle the higher bandwidth requirements of advanced in-vehicle applications. This transition will enable faster data transmission, which is essential for real-time communication between vehicles and external systems. Additionally, the shift towards connected ecosystems, where vehicles interact with smart cities and IoT (Internet of Things) devices, is further driving the adoption of multi-antenna access points in the automotive industry.
